A diagnostic tachometer should be used for
this procedure. Results may vary depending
on whether testing is conducted with the
flushing attachment, in a test tank, or with the
outboard motor in the water.
1. Start the engine and allow it to warm up
fully in neutral until it is running smooth-
ly.
NOTE:
Correct idling speed inspection is only possi-
ble if the engine is fully warmed up. If not
warmed up fully, the idle speed will measure
higher than normal. If you have difficulty ver-
ifying the idle speed, or the idle speed re-
quires adjustment, consult a PowertecOut-
Boards dealer
or other qualified mechanic.
2.
Verify whether the idle speed is set to
specification. For idle speed specifica-
tions, see page 46.

Checking wiring and connectors

Check that each grounding wire is properly
secured.
Check that each connector is engaged se-
curely.

Exhaust leakage

Start the engine and check that no exhaust
leaks from the joints between the exhaust
cover, cylinder head, and body cylinder.

Water leakage

Start the engine and check that no water
leaks from the joints between the exhaust
cover, cylinder head, and body cylinder.
Checking power trim and tilt / power
tilt system
WARNING
Never get under the lower unit while it
is tilted, even when the tilt support lever
is locked. Severe injury could occur if
the outboard motor accidentally falls.
Make sure no one is under the outboard
motor before performing this test.
Check the power trim and tilt unit / the
power tilt unit for any sign of oil leaks.
1. Trim and tilt rod
2. Tilt support lever
Operate each of the power trim and tilt
switches / the power tilt switches on the
remote control and engine bottom cowl-
ing (if equipped) to check that all switch-
es work.
Tilt the outboard motor up and check
that the trim and tilt rod / the tilt rod is
pushed out completely.
Check that the trim and tilt rod / the tilt
rod is free of corrosion or other flaws.
